How Much Do I Spend on Wedding Gift?

Navigating the world of wedding gifts can be quite challenging, especially when it comes to determining how much you should spend. The amount you choose to spend on a wedding gift is a personal decision, influenced by various factors such as your relationship with the couple, your financial situation, and cultural norms. In this article, we will explore the different aspects to consider when deciding how much to spend on a wedding gift.

Understanding the Relationship

The first and foremost factor to consider is your relationship with the couple. If you are close friends or family members, you may want to spend a bit more on the gift. On the other hand, if you are acquaintances or colleagues, a more modest gift may suffice. Keep in mind that the thought and effort put into the gift are often more important than the price tag.

Financial Situation

Your financial situation plays a significant role in determining how much you can afford to spend on a wedding gift. It’s essential to be realistic about your budget and avoid overspending. If you are on a tight budget, consider giving a thoughtful, personalized gift rather than an expensive one. Remember, the couple will appreciate your gesture, regardless of the price.

Cultural Norms

Cultural norms can vary greatly when it comes to wedding gift etiquette. In some cultures, it is customary to spend a specific amount, such as $50 to $100 per person. In other cultures, the amount may be significantly higher. Research the cultural norms of the couple and their families to ensure you are giving an appropriate gift.

Gift Type

The type of gift you choose can also influence how much you should spend. For example, if you are gifting a registry item, the price is often predetermined by the couple. In this case, you can simply follow their guidelines. However, if you are purchasing a non-registry gift, consider the following:

– The couple’s interests and needs
– The value of the gift relative to its cost
– The uniqueness of the gift

Thoughtful Over Pricey

Ultimately, the most important aspect of a wedding gift is the thought and effort put into it. A heartfelt, personalized gift can often be more meaningful than an expensive one. Consider giving a gift that reflects the couple’s personalities, interests, or shared experiences.
